Regional labels matter: Cantonese, Sichuan, Hunan, Shanghainese and Taiwanese kitchens cook very differently, so a restaurant's stated region is a better guide to the food than the word "Chinese" alone. Some smaller restaurants in California are BYOB with no corkage fee; call ahead to confirm. A tip of 15-20% is customary for table service but not expected at counter-order takeout. Spice level, MSG and allergen questions are normal to ask before ordering, and most kitchens are happy to leave an ingredient out or tone down the heat if you mention it when ordering rather than after the food arrives.

Juaren Frausto 7 years ago

I would definitely recommend trying this place out. While there are fancier places around, the staff is super friendly and the portion sizes are pretty decent. You get enough food for the amount you pay. It is popular with college students and can get a little busy during lunch hours. I'd recommend getting the entrees as they come with a main course, rice, soup and a small salad.

Jennifer Law 8 years ago

The spicy fish lunch special that I ordered was tasty and the eggplant was also good. The rice had a weird consistency but overall, it was just as I expected. I'd recommend this place! Just FYI, credit card minimum is $10 or they charge an extra $1.

MileageMayVary 9 years ago

Came over for a quick bite before an appointment, was pleased to know they have a to-go menu and services. Came back after the appointment and tried out their desserts, unfortunately they ran out of toast. Their toffee black tea was delicious! Their sesame balls were lightly toasted and scrumptious. Best ones I've had in a while. β™‘ I'd love to come back to try their entrΓ©e and dinner menu.
